Clustering Analysis for the Delayed Flocking Model with Multi-topology Structures

Abstract: Flocking behavior is a common phenomenon in nature. The research of flocking theory has been widely applied in economy, military and management. This paper studies the group behavior of two models with time delays under different topology structures, and obtains necessary and sufficient conditions. For the Cucker-Smale type model with directed graphs, we get the necessary and sufficient conditions of time delay .For another model with competitive relationship between individuals under bipartite graph, we also explore the influence of time delay on group behavior, and get the necessary and sufficient conditions. Finally, we verify the correctness of the conclusion by numerical simulation. 

Key words: Directed graph, Flocking-cluster , Time delay, Bipartite graph
